We will approach this problem in three ways. Initially we will look at the maximum timing resolution that can be envisaged as being required for pulsar timing with SKA1 in the absence of interstellar scattering. Taking this derived limit, we will then consider how this limit evolves with dispersion measure when we take into account interstellar scattering. Finally we will consider the computational complexity of the problem at hand and will discuss the implications of our findings on the design and cost of the pulsar timing hardware from SKA1\_Low and SKA1\_Mid.   This document does not contain a comprehensive discussion of the timing properties of pulsar as a function of frequency and DM. Instead we aim here to provide a rudimentary argument that may be considered reasonable without requiring an in depth analysis.
